### Step 4: Point the Reminder Job at the New Database

The ClinicPing reminder job now reads appointment slots from the consolidated schedule store instead of the legacy flat files. Plugin authors: update your config loader to pull the datasource from the job context rather than hardcoding it. For local testing, use the connection string below.

replica DSN, yahaf-yagaf: mongodb://tamath_svc:a2netSk3RZMuTj@db-d084.novacsoft.internal:5432/ralmir

The FareSplit experiment engine controls the A/B ticket-pricing trial for the Bramblehook Festival platform. Before deploying, copy `env.sample` to `.env` on the experiment host and review every value. Set `FARESPLIT_COHORT_RATIO` to match the experiment plan approved by the pricing committee, and confirm `FARESPLIT_FLUSH_INTERVAL` is 60 seconds so results land in the warehouse promptly. Variant assignments are signed so clients cannot tamper with their bucket. Finish the file with the signing key entry, which goes on the following line.

secret setting of kawif-haweg: COURIER_KEY8=0cf7bc02

Handover Note — Helmvik Plant Capacity

From: A. Drennar, Director of Manufacturing
To: L. Osei-Varn, Director of Strategy

For the finance team: the decision to expand Line 3 at the Helmvik plant is approved in principle, contingent on revised demand figures from the Quillon account. Capital estimates have been rechecked twice; the variance sits within the agreed tolerance. Depreciation schedules and the phased spend profile are in the shared workbook, tabbed by quarter. Please treat the attached reasoning with discretion, as outlined below.

board note of kageg-bahof: The renewal with Holwynax Holdings closes at $2 million a year, 5 percent below the last contract. Project Ulaath slips by two quarters because of the supplier delay.

## Authentication

Quick heads-up: the Brambleshelf catalog cache invalidates on every SKU write, so don't hammer the refresh endpoint — it's already eager. If listings look stale, it's almost always an auth failure on the invalidation worker, not the cache itself. The worker talks to our internal Purgecast service, and new teammates usually trip on setting this up. For local dev, use the shared staging key below.

gateway credential: kto3_qfe